This book provides scholars and students examining Korea's place in modern world politics with an invaluable resource for understanding the causes, course, and consequences of the ongoing crisis on the Korean Peninsula.

• Provides readers with an understanding of the reasons for the existence of two nations on the Korean Peninsula

• Exposes how outside powers have intervened in Korean affairs throughout its modern history—with disastrous results

• Explains the development of North Korea into an isolated nation with a government determined to possess nuclear weapons

• Suggests avenues for Korea's reunification and the achievement of permanent peace and stability on the peninsula
